Public police records are created, held, maintained and updated by authorized persons or agents who work for state, local, and county law enforcement agencies, including the Department of Justice, FBI and Drug Enforcement Administration (DEA).They’re part of police cases and contain instances of a criminal nature, such as DUIs, Arrest Warrants, Arrest Logs, Traffic Violations and Search Warrants. They mainly consist of Incident Reports and Arrest Records, with data such as Defendant’s Full Name, Charged Offense, Bail Amount and Court Date. They only unveil a part of a person’s full criminal history, as they do not include court documents and convictions. ![]() Public police records are official filesthat hold information about people's criminal activity. ![]()
